Customs or Import duty for Football and rugby balls to Barbados

The Customs or Import duty for Football & rugby balls to Barbados is classified under Sports & Outdoors(cdf categories).

The HSCODE applied for Football & rugby balls is 95-6-62-90-0

The tax is applied on the total sum of item cost, insurance cost and shipment cost.

The custom/import taxes are:

General duty is 10%

Special Tariff rate 1 is 0%

The average VAT rate applicable in Barbados is 0.175

Note: If the special tariff rate is NULL then general duty is applicable.

Calculation method:

Customs Duties or Import duty and taxes will be pending and need to be cleared while importing goods into Barbados whether by a private individual or a commercial entity.

The valuation method is CIF.

Below table provide the Duty and Sales tax for Barbados:

Duty Rates Average Duty Rate Sales Tax(GST) Threshold on goods
0% to 70% 17.45% 17.5% (CIF value + duty + Excise Duty + Environmental Levy) No threshold
  • For alcohol and tobacco Excise Duty will applicable on quantity base.
  • Entry Processing Fee will be charged at flat rate of BBD10 per import.
  • Environmental Levy will be charged if applicable.
